Output d2857f8116b71c3c603b200e80d1fe1696e5005fe53943bdcf963bec47db02a6:1

value
2908720
script pubkey
OP_0 OP_PUSHBYTES_20 90e77ea649e381d3dd819716c0ef8d4ffcc8f1a2
address
ltc1qjrnhafjfuwqa8hvpjutvpmudfl7v3udzcdxvxc
transaction
d2857f8116b71c3c603b200e80d1fe1696e5005fe53943bdcf963bec47db02a6
spent
true